WebLogic Server 9.2集群配置指南

需积分: 3 2 下载量 124 浏览量 更新于2024-09-21 收藏 2.85MB DOC 举报
"在AIX环境下配置WebLogic Server 9.2集群以及多服务器的教程" WebLogic Server 集群是一种将多个独立的服务器实例组合在一起,形成一个整体服务单元的技术,它提供了高可用性、负载均衡和扩展性。在AIX操作系统上配置WebLogic集群,有助于确保关键应用程序的稳定性和性能。 预备知识: 在深入集群配置之前,我们需要理解WebLogic Server的基础概念。Domain是WebLogic Server管理的核心单位,它包含了服务器实例、受管理服务器、数据源、JMS资源等所有相关组件。一个Domain可以有一个管理服务器(Administrator Server),负责管理域内的其他WebLogic Server实例,这些实例可以是单独的服务器或者服务器集群。每个Server都有特定的角色和职责,例如提供Web服务、EJB服务等。 配置WebLogic Server集群: 在WebLogic Server 9.2中,集群有两种常见的架构模式: 1. 单层混合型集群架构:所有Web应用和服务都部署在同一集群内的服务器上。这种架构简单易管理,能实现灵活的负载均衡,并提供增强的安全性。 2. 多层结构的集群架构:分为两个集群,一个用于静态内容和集群Servlet,另一个用于集群EJB。这种架构适用于需要更复杂的负载平衡策略、内容与服务分离,以及提高系统稳定性的场景。 配置WebLogic集群的先决条件: - 所有服务器必须位于同一网络子网,并能通过IP广播(UDP)互相通信。 - 服务器需使用相同版本的WebLogic Server,包括Service Pack。 - 集群中的每个服务器必须使用静态IP地址,不支持动态IP。 - 如果服务器位于防火墙后,为了客户端访问,需要有公共静态IP地址。 - 必须拥有包含CLUSTER许可的许可证才能配置集群,WebLogic的试用版本通常已包含这一许可。 配置前的准备工作: 在开始集群配置之前,应规划好集群的结构、确定服务器数量、分配IP地址,以及考虑负载均衡策略。还需要设置好网络环境,确保服务器间的通信畅通。此外,安装和配置WebLogic Server的基础工作也要提前完成,包括安装软件、创建Domain以及初始化管理服务器。 配置过程主要包括以下几个步骤: 1. 创建新的Domain或使用现有Domain。 2. 在Domain内创建集群。 3. 启动额外的Server实例并将其添加到集群中。 4. 配置集群属性,如负载均衡策略、故障转移规则等。 5. 部署应用程序到集群。 6. 测试集群的正确性和性能。 在整个配置过程中,需要注意的是,AIX作为Unix系统,可能需要特别关注权限设置、网络配置和系统服务的管理。同时,对于集群的监控和日志分析也是保持集群健康运行的重要环节。 通过遵循上述步骤和注意事项,你将在AIX环境中成功地配置WebLogic Server 9.2集群,实现高效且可靠的多服务器部署。